奇狐社區論壇
在這個頁面顯示本主題全部的 5 個文章

奇狐社區論壇 (http://www.chiefox.com.tw/bbs/index.php)
- 問題交流 (http://www.chiefox.com.tw/bbs/forumdisplay.php?forumid=28)
-- [問題]函數'SETVAL' (http://www.chiefox.com.tw/bbs/showthread.php?threadid=23532)


由 Markchu7 在 2022-12-22 10:50 發表:

[問題]函數'SETVAL'

有關函數'SETVAL'的說明並不是很了解!
可否請總版主以MA(C,20)為例,寫下公式以供參考!
我的問題是MA(C,20)第一個數據產生前的19個周期以第一個MA(C,20)數據填滿!
如此的需求是使用函數'SETVAL'嗎?還是其他另外的函數?請指導!感恩!


由 cgjj 在 2022-12-22 11:40 發表:

回覆: [問題]函數'SETVAL'

引用:
最初由 Markchu7 發表
有關函數'SETVAL'的說明並不是很了解!
可否請總版主以MA(C,20)為例,寫下公式以供參考!
我的問題是MA(C,20)第一個數據產生前的19個周期以第一個MA(C,20)數據填滿!
如此的需求是使用函數'SETVAL'嗎?還是其他另外的函數?請指導!感恩!



不需要用SETVAL
但這樣處理等於是引用未來數據唷,使用上要小心!

MA20:MA(C,20);
LB:=lbound(MA20);
MA20:=if(barpos<LB,MA20[LB],MA20);


由 Markchu7 在 2022-12-22 12:54 發表:

感謝總版主溫馨提醒!有您真好!但可能有些小誤會了!
我知道是未來函數,但主要我是想了解與熟悉有關'SETVAL'這個函數的寫法,說實在的函數說明有點看不懂,所以想說用個例子,看會不會比較明白,感恩!


由 cgjj 在 2022-12-22 15:30 發表:

引用:
最初由 Markchu7 發表
感謝總版主溫馨提醒!有您真好!但可能有些小誤會了!
我知道是未來函數,但主要我是想了解與熟悉有關'SETVAL'這個函數的寫法,說實在的函數說明有點看不懂,所以想說用個例子,看會不會比較明白,感恩!



SETVAL 並無法在無效的位置填值唷~
此例並不合適!!!


由 Markchu7 在 2022-12-22 21:05 發表:

OK,收到!


全部時間均為台灣時間, 現在時間為00:44
在這個頁面顯示本主題全部的 5 個文章


Powered by: vBulletin Version 2.3.0 - Copyright©2000-, Jelsoft Enterprises Limited.

簡愛洋行 製作 Copyright 2003-. All Rights Reserved.